## Changelog — Proselint-like tooling (Inkvetter 1.4)

Renamed: `INKVETTER_RULES_TOKEN` is now `INKVETTER_RULESET_KEY` to clarify that it authorizes fetching the shared ruleset bundle, not individual rules. The old name still works through 1.5 with a deprecation warning; migration is a one-line rename in your env file. Reviewers should confirm no CI config references the old name. Once renamed, the env file should declare the key on the line that follows.

env line for fafof-fahag: LEDGER_TOKEN5=f8790

// DRIVER_ASSIGN_RADIUS_KM
//
// Heuristic cap for the Pellcart dispatcher: only consider drivers within
// this radius before widening the search. Bumping it past 8 floods the
// scorer and spikes assignment latency. If paged for slow matches, check
// this first. Last validated under the trace below.

session token of kageg-tahop = htk14_af3c1ccccb7dcf

Subject: On-call intro — the Drumline queue-depth autoscaler

Hi Saela, welcome aboard. Since external plugin authors can enqueue work directly, you'll want to understand Drumline, our queue-depth autoscaler, before your first shift. It scales worker pods based on a rolling five-minute average of queue depth, with a hard ceiling of forty pods. Misbehaving plugins can flood the queue and pin us at the ceiling — that's your most common page. Throttling levers and dashboards are documented on the internal page below.

wiki page, tahaf-tajog: https://jira.ordindyn.corp/pipeline

// Setup for the Keywhirl rotation client — this is the thing that swaps out
// stale secrets across the Dunmore cluster every Sunday night. If it pages
// you, it's usually a lease timeout; just rerun with --force-renew.
// It bootstraps against the internal Vaultling API using the key below.

gateway credential: kto23_LX9A4ys6i4nzHtpOLNLodKK